Recruiting Coordinator/ Talent Operations
5 days ago
**_ Note: We are targeting Pacific and Mountain time zones for this role._**
**Day-to-day**:
- Partner with recruiters and hiring managers to ensure a consistent and quick process
- Help with managing our internal recruiting systems including: Greenhouse, Talentwall, Survale, Findem and more- Systems management includes: posting jobs, updating permissions and workflows, pulling reports, running analytics, following up on surveys, and more
**What we are looking for**:
- 3+ years of recruiting coordination experience managing high volume scheduling requests across multiple geographic locations
- 1+ year of recruiting systems management experience
- Deep passion for Talent Acquisition systems and processes
- High level attention to detail, superb organizational skills and desire to learn and grow- Ability to manage multiple high priorities simultaneously
- Experience working with confidential data
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Must be very personable with a positive attitude and the grit to succeed in all endeavors
**Bonus Points**:
- Experience with sourcing tools like Findem, LI Recruiter, etc.
- Startup and/ or SaaS experience
**About Narvar**
- We're on a mission to simplify the everyday lives of consumers. Post-purchase is a critical phase of the customer journey. That's why we created Narvar - a platform focused on driving customer loyalty through seamless post-purchase experiences that allow retailers to retain, engage, and delight customers. If you've ever bought something online, there's a good chance you've used our platform_
- From the hottest new direct-to-consumer companies to retail's most renowned brands, Narvar works with GameStop, Neiman Marcus, Sonos, Nike, and 1500+ other brands. With hubs in San Francisco, London, and Bangalore, we've served over 125 million consumers worldwide across 10+ billion interactions, 38 countries, and 55 languages._
- Pioneering the post-purchase movement means navigating into the unknown. Our team thrives on this sense of adventure while nurturing a mindset of innovation. We're a home for big hearts and we leave our egos at the door. We work hard but we always make time to celebrate professional wins, baby showers, birthday parties, and everything in between._
